2-year-old girl in Inabanga town latest Covid-19 patient in Bohol

The province’s latest Covid-19 patient is a two-year-old girl from Inabanga town, the first case of local transmission.

Inabanga Mayor Josephine “Roygie” Jumamoy, on her official statement, said that the girl, a resident of Barangay Maria Rosario, was admitted to Francisco Dagohoy Memorial Hospital (FDMH) due to Covid-19 symptoms.

Jumamoy said before the results of her swab sample was released, the child was discharged and sent home by the hospital on Thursday afternoon (October 8).

Jumamoy said she was informed by the Department of Health – Central Visayas on Thursday night (October 8) that the child was tested positive for Covid-19 thru reverse transcription pol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) test.

The child and her family were immediately brought to the barangay isolation facility, while contact tracing was immediately conducted.

Jumamoy advised her constituents to strictly follow the minimum public health standards.
